Zombies from Outer Space is a quirky blend of comedy, horror, and science fiction that embraces its low-budget roots. The film has this whimsical yet eerie tone, making you chuckle in between the unsettling moments. The pacing is a bit uneven, but that somehow adds to its charm—kind of like those old B-movies you can't help but love. The practical effects are delightfully old-school; there's something refreshing about seeing actual puppetry and makeup instead of CGI. Performances are a mixed bag, but the over-the-top characters really stand out, adding to that campy feel. It's distinct in its oddball humor juxtaposed with genuine horror elements, a real oddity in the genre.
